Storm window replacement services involve removing old, damaged, or inefficient storm windows and installing new units to improve a property's overall comfort and energy efficiency. This process typically includes measuring existing window openings, selecting suitable replacement storm windows, and securely installing them to ensure proper fit and function. The goal is to create a barrier that helps keep drafts, moisture, and noise out, while also preventing air leaks that can lead to higher heating and cooling costs. Local contractors experienced in storm window replacement can handle all aspects of the installation, ensuring that the new windows operate smoothly and provide long-lasting performance.

Many homeowners seek storm window replacement services to address common problems such as drafts, condensation, and difficulty opening or closing existing storm windows. Over time, storm windows can become warped, cracked, or damaged by weather exposure, reducing their effectiveness. Replacing them can help improve indoor comfort, especially during colder months when drafts are most noticeable. Additionally, new storm windows can help protect the primary windows from further damage and extend their lifespan. Property owners may notice increased energy bills or discomfort in rooms with older, inefficient storm windows, signaling that a replacement could be beneficial.

The overview below groups typical Storm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Harford County,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or storm window repairs or replacements range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the window size and repair complexity. Fewer projects reach the higher end of the spectrum.

Standard Replacement - Replacing multiple storm windows across a home us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Local contractors often handle these projects efficiently within this range, with larger or more customized jobs potentially exceeding $3,500.

Full Window Replacement - Complete storm window replacements for an entire house can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to fall into the higher end of this range, though many homes are completed within the middle tiers.

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Custom storm window installations or extensive upgrades can exceed $10,000 depending on the scope and materials used. These projects are less common and typically involve more intricate or high-end window systems.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are storm windows and how do they improve home comfort? Storm windows are additional window layers installed on the exterior or interior of existing windows, helping to reduce drafts and improve insulation, which can make indoor spaces more comfortable.

How do local contractors handle storm window replacement projects? Local service providers assess existing windows, recommend suitable storm window options, and professionally install them to ensure proper fit and performance.

Are storm window replacements suitable for historic homes? Yes, many local contractors offer storm window solutions that preserve the aesthetic of historic homes while providing added insulation and protection.

What types of storm windows are available for residential properties? Common options include aluminum, vinyl, and wood-frame storm windows, each offering different durability and aesthetic qualities to match various home styles.

How can homeowners determine if storm window replacement is necessary? Signs such as drafts, condensation between window panes, or difficulty maintaining indoor temperature may indicate that replacing or upgrading storm windows could be beneficial.
